EDMOND, Okla. - The UT Dallas women's basketball team finished the season with a 74-62 victory over Oklahoma Christian at the Eagles' Nest Saturday afternoon.
The Comets (13-14, 10-10 Lone Star Conference) ended the year with a three-game win streak and tied for eighth place in their inaugural LSC campaign. If eligible, UTD would have qualified for the LSC Championship Tournament in Frisco, Texas.
The visitors led the Eagles (12-15, 8-12 LSC) 19-7 after the first quarter 36-25 at halftime. OC started the third period on an 11-4 run to cut the deficit to four points. The Comets pushed the lead to as many as 19 in the fourth.
UTD shot 41.3 percent (26-of-63) from the field, 2-of-10 from three-point range and 20-of-24 at the free throw line with 34 rebounds, 16 assists, 17 turnovers, four blocks and eight steals.
The Eagles shot 34.5 percent (20-of-58) overall, 5-of-12 from outside and 17-of-30 at the charity stripe to go with 33 rebounds, eight assists, 18 turnovers, five blocks and nine steals.

Comets in the Record Books
- UTD set school records with 125 blocked shots and 4.69 blocks per game this year.
- They finished with the second-best free percentage in school history at 75.2 percent.
- Self finished her career tied for fifth in program history with 496 rebounds and third with 89 blocked shots. She was also second in career rebounds per game and in the top 10 in assists per game, assist/turnover ratio, steals per game and blocks per game.
- Yellen ended her career ranked eighth in three-pointers made with 94.
- Self was also third on the Comet list with 45 blocks this season, fifth with 210 rebounds and fifth at 7.8 rebounds per game.
- Otsuka became the 12th player at UTD to finish with more than 400 points in a season (401).
- Oyakhire ended her freshman season in fifth place with 34 blocked shots.
